Seattle cream cheese dogs are a delightful twist on the classic hot dog, combining the savory flavors of grilled hot dogs with the creamy richness of cream cheese and the sweet, caramelized taste of sautéed onions. This unique combination creates a mouthwatering experience that is sure to impress your family and friends at your next cookout.
While most of the ingredients for Seattle cream cheese dogs are common pantry staples, you may need to ensure you have a package of softened cream cheese on hand. This ingredient is essential for achieving the signature creamy texture that sets these hot dogs apart. If you don't already have it at home, be sure to pick some up at the supermarket.

Technique Tip for This Recipe
To achieve perfectly caramelized onions, cook them slowly over medium-low heat, stirring occasionally. This allows the natural sugars in the onions to break down and develop a rich, sweet flavor without burning. Patience is key for this step to enhance the overall taste of your Seattle Cream Cheese Dogs.

How to Store or Freeze This Dish
- Allow the hot dogs and onions to cool completely before storing. This prevents condensation, which can make the buns soggy.
- Wrap each hot dog individually in aluminum foil or plastic wrap to maintain freshness and prevent them from sticking together.
- Place the wrapped hot dogs in an airtight container or a resealable plastic bag to keep them from absorbing any unwanted odors from the fridge.
- Store the container or bag in the refrigerator if you plan to consume the Seattle cream cheese dogs within 2-3 days.
- For longer storage, place the wrapped hot dogs in a freezer-safe bag or container. Label with the date to keep track of their freshness.
- When ready to eat, thaw the hot dogs in the refrigerator overnight if frozen.
- Reheat the hot dogs in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 10-15 minutes, or until heated through. Alternatively, you can microwave them on medium power for 1-2 minutes.
- If the cream cheese has become too firm, spread a fresh layer of softened cream cheese on the buns before reheating.
- Add freshly sautéed onions if desired, to bring back the original caramelized flavor and texture.
How to Reheat Leftovers
- Preheat your oven to 350°F. Wrap each hot dog in aluminum foil to keep them moist. Place them on a baking sheet and heat for 10-15 minutes until warmed through.
- For a quicker method, use a microwave. Place the hot dogs on a microwave-safe plate and cover with a damp paper towel. Heat on high for 1-2 minutes, checking halfway through to ensure even heating.
- If you prefer a crispy bun, use a toaster oven. Set it to 350°F and place the hot dogs directly on the rack. Heat for about 10 minutes, keeping an eye on them to avoid burning.
- To reheat the caramelized onions, use a skillet over medium heat. Add a small amount of olive oil and sauté until they are warmed through.
- For the cream cheese, let it come to room temperature naturally or give it a quick zap in the microwave for 10-15 seconds to soften it up before spreading on the buns.

Seattle Cream Cheese Dogs Recipe
Ingredients
Main Ingredients
- 4 Hot dog buns
- 4 Hot dogs
- 1 Onion, sliced
- 1 package Cream cheese softened
Instructions
- 1. Preheat your grill to medium-high heat.
- 2. Grill the hot dogs until heated through and slightly charred.
- 3. In a skillet, sauté the sliced onions until they are golden and caramelized.
- 4. Spread a generous amount of softened cream cheese inside each hot dog bun.
- 5. Place the grilled hot dogs in the buns and top with the caramelized onions.
- 6. Serve immediately and enjoy!
